Man flees after downstate shootout
Posted by wlpo on May 8, 2016
A man, possibly wounded last night downstate, is being sought for the attempted murder of a police officer. Illinois State Police said Sunday that 35-year old Dracy “Clint” Pendleton and a Mahomet police officer exchanged gunfire about 10:45pm Saturday night. The officer was hit in the arm, but Pendleton is also believed to be wounded and may seek medical attention.
Pendleton is described as a white male, 35 years old, 5’ 10”, 155 lbs, blue eyes and blonde hair. He may be carrying an AK-47 and driving a stolen 2007 white GMC Pick-up truck with the license number 16 55 33 B. The Champaign County States Attorney has issued an arrest warrant for Pendleton for the attempted murder of a police officer.
